East Riding of Yorkshire, England, United Kingdom Voted one of the best places to live in the UK, Beverley is also one of Yorkshire’s best kept secrets. Renowned for its exquisite 13th Century Minster, the town is home to a lively market, a thriving music scene, excellent flat racing and a medieval skyline that remains refreshingly unspoilt.

With an outstanding range of independent shops, cafes, pubs and restaurants as well as the larger supermarkets.

Restaurants are all within walking distance – the town centre has a vast array of tastes to suit every pallet to name a few; Italian, English, French and Japanese.

There are a number of fast food take outs – independents and larger chains including MacDonald’s & Pizza Express. There are several small coffee houses and tea rooms. A locally well-known local public house, Nellies (more appropriately known as the White Horse) is still lit by gas light.

Beverley holds several special events including Beverley races (25 minutes walk), Folk Festival, Comedy Festival and Puppet Festival. There is a food festival, a Georgian festival and a Victorian weekend with the Christmas Market.
